<p>Over the next several weeks, prior to the high school season kicking off, we are going to highlight a prospect on each team throughout the state of Iowa, that is vital to the success of their Varsity program over the next six months. To start things off, we are going to lock in with the biggest Class in the state and that is the 5A Class. In this specific piece, we highlight the schools of Marshalltown, Cedar Rapids - Jefferson, Dubuque Senior, Dubuque Hempstead, Iowa City - West, Iowa City - City High, Bettendorf, and Sioux City East. </p>

<p class="text-gray-700">The state of Iowa was introduced to [player_tooltip player_id='832207' first='Frankie' last='Long'] last season when she stepped onto the Varsity floor at Marshalltown. For her rendition this time around, Long will look to build on her fast start. At 6'1, you can imagine that this is someone who thrives in the departments of scoring and rebounding around the rim. Within the conference that this team competes in and the opponents that they will face, it's not crazy to imagine that Long could do even better than a year ago. She just needs the support behind her and the rest could be history. </p>

<p class="text-gray-700">There are actually several factors that are going to impact the season of the CR Jefferson Jayhawks program this Winter but the most important may come in the middle with their Center, [player_tooltip player_id='642075' first='Lillie' last='Spicer']. Spicer has been a force in the painted area's ever since she was young but this season is going to be a big one in her journey. I need to see that Spicer can demonstrate a counter move when need be offensively, while also being a killer on defense. On that side of the ball, Spicer usually finishes contests with nice numbers in the rebounds and blocks department but she could definitely add to that ability moving forward. Not only is Spicer 6'0, she has physical awareness of the situations unfolding around her, and she isn't afraid to mix it up with anyone. Three things that will help her continue to kill it for her Sophomore season.</p>

<p class="text-gray-700">[player_tooltip player_id='311373' first='August' last='Palmer'] is coming back to IC - City High for one last time as she looks to solidify her high school career. Palmer has been a star ever since she was a Freshman at West Branch. After transferring to City, the question was always if she could compete at that high level and the answer is a resounding yes. Since then, Palmer has committed to reigning D2 Champs - Minnesota State and she is excited to see where that could take her. This is someone that is very determined in her mindset. Anything she puts her mind to, she accomplishes and that can be a very powerful weapon in not only the game of basketball, but the game of life.</p>

<p class="text-gray-700">[player_tooltip player_id='1055303' first='Janina' last='Williams'] of Dubuque Senior might only be 5'9 but she is the tallest listed player on their roster returning from a year ago. Williams led her Dubuque Senior Ram's team during the 2023 - 2024 in RPG as a Freshman, while only averaging just over 4.5 PPG. Some might not think that Williams will impact the play of the Ram's that much moving forward but I do. She is someone that obviously has heart, a motor, and some skill while on the court. If the team can work around that and the upperclassmen continue to step up, they should do much better than a year ago. </p>

<p class="text-gray-700">Another passing of the torch situation is happening at Dubuque Hempstead in between last season and current with the graduation of their past star, Camdyn Kay, who is now at NAIA - Clarke out of Dubuque. The next in line to take lead for this group is going to be [player_tooltip player_id='1055304' first='Sydney' last='Feldhacker'] by the looks of it. Feldhacker was only a Freshman last Winter at the SF position but she held her own. Really the team was led by Kay but Feldhacker did her part and made productive steps because of it. This time around, it's going to be her team to lead, as long as she is lock into that challenge.</p>

<p class="text-gray-700">One of the most eye opening situations that the State of Iowa has had in the off-season is the turnover at Sioux City East High School. Coming into this season, they lose their top 4 producing prospects due to graduation/transfer, so there is going to be a lot of chances for opportunity moving into this Winter. Someone that is returning for her Senior season, that could eat up those chances is SG - [player_tooltip player_id='1055305' first='Kiki' last='Demke']. For all intents and purposes, Demke is someone that put up solid numbers in her attempts last year. On the season, she shot the ball just over 75 times, with over 55 of them being from behind the three point arc, kinda giving you an idea of what she wants to do. This Winter she is going to have to play on the ball more if she wants her team to see success but that's something I'm sure she will be ready to handle. </p>

<p class="text-gray-700">When looking at the point of this article, you could say that the two main producers for the Bettendorf Bulldogs will be their "vital" player this Winter but I think it's going to be their surrounding cast that matters the most. If team's are smart, they will double, even triple the Bulldogs best prospects and that will make everyone else step up, players like college bound SG - [player_tooltip player_id='842677' first='Alivia' last='Carr']. Carr has an offer or two to compete at the next level following this Winter and whenever she goes, she is going to be solid in her endeavors. This is someone as a prospect that can move well off of the ball, she can screen and flash away for a pull up jumper or she can cut behind the defense for an easy bucket near the rim. It's going to be a really fun season to see what this group can put together these next six months. That's for sure and I can't wait.</p>

<p class="text-gray-700">[player_tooltip player_id='641977' first='Grace' last='Fincham'] is really a mismatch nightmare when it comes to both sides of the ball. Fincham competes for Iowa City West Trojan at 5'10 and she moves between the inside of the paint, all the way outside to the perimeter past the three point line. Her standing height mixed with her ability to move down the floor is eye opening when you see it in live action. Offensively, she can post smaller defender or step out and screen with action going toward the hoop or the outside. Defensively, she can stay with bigger prospects, even through physical play and she can stick to smaller prospects if need be on a switch. All in all, The Trojans are going to be able to make a run this year with their roster and Fincham will be in the middle of that production.</p>
